What is the paradox as related to slavery in the United States?
EastWind [94]

Hey there!

The answer is A. That slavery was still allowed in a free nation.

One of the things the colonists fought for was freedom. Freedom of speech, freedom of religion, and freedom of the press along with other things.

However, for hundreds of thousands of slaves torn away from their homes, they had none of these freedoms. They were considered inferior and not people.

A paradox is a statement that seems absurd of self-contradictory, which this statement very much is. If the U.S. is a free nation, then why do hundreds of thousands of people living there have no freedoms, stolen from them by the very people who advocated for their own freedom?

The Share Our Wealth movement was: a. led by Father Charles E. Coughlin and directed at Catholics. b. introduced by Franklin Roo
REY [17]

Answer:

Option D, led by Louisiana senator Huey Long and gained a national following, is the right answer.

Explanation:

A movement led by Huey Long during the Great Depression is known as Share Our Wealth Movement. It was a poverty program for the poor. He appealed to the rich of the country to donate their money among the poor or those who don't have any or much. Therefore, it may be said that it was a program designed to provide a satisfactory living standard to all the American population.
